1. Embrace Coastal Colors

Opt for a soothing color palette that reflects the beauty of the sea and sand. Shades of blue, aqua, sandy beige, and crisp white create a serene and airy ambiance. Consider using light-colored tiles or shiplap walls to enhance the coastal feel.

2. Use Natural Materials

Incorporate natural materials like wood, stone, and bamboo to bring in a touch of nature. Driftwood-inspired vanities, pebble-stone shower floors, and rattan light fixtures can add texture and warmth to the space.

3. Install Large Windows or Skylights

Maximize natural light and take advantage of stunning ocean views by adding large windows or skylights. If privacy is a concern, consider frosted glass or strategically placed windows that still allow light to flow in while maintaining discretion.

4. Choose Water-Resistant and Durable Materials

Beachfront homes are exposed to humidity, salt air, and moisture, so selecting the right materials is crucial. Opt for porcelain or ceramic tiles that resist water damage, marine-grade wood for cabinetry, and stainless steel or brass fixtures to prevent corrosion.

5. Upgrade to a Walk-In Shower

A walk-in shower with a frameless glass enclosure creates an open, spa-like feel while offering easy maintenance. Consider adding a rain showerhead for a luxurious experience and using subway tiles or mosaic designs for added style.

6. Add Coastal-Inspired Fixtures and Décor

Incorporate nautical and coastal-inspired elements to enhance the beachfront vibe. Rope-framed mirrors, seashell or coral décor, and ocean-themed artwork can tie the design together without overwhelming the space.

7. Enhance Storage with Built-In Solutions

To keep your bathroom clutter-free, install built-in shelves or recessed niches in the shower for storage. A floating vanity with drawers or woven baskets can also help maintain a tidy and stylish look.

8. Install Smart and Energy-Efficient Features

Consider upgrading to smart bathroom features such as motion-sensor lighting, a heated towel rack, or a humidity-sensing exhaust fan. Additionally, opt for water-saving fixtures like low-flow toilets and faucets to enhance sustainability.

9. Use Statement Lighting

Proper lighting enhances the ambiance of a bathroom. Consider pendant lights, wall sconces, or LED mirrors to add a touch of elegance while ensuring functionality.

10. Incorporate Indoor Plants

Bring a bit of greenery into your bathroom with moisture-loving plants such as ferns, orchids, or aloe vera. These not only purify the air but also add a refreshing natural element to the space.
